Laeviheterohelix glabrans


Classification: pf_mesozoic -> Heterohelicidae -> Laeviheterohelix -> Laeviheterohelix glabrans
Sister taxa: L. dentata, L. flabelliformis, L. glabrans, L. pulchra, L. reniformis, L. turgida, L. sp.

Taxonomy

Citation: Laeviheterohelix glabrans (Cushman, 1938)
Rank: Species
Basionym: Guembelina glabrans
Synonyms:

Type images:

Original description: Test nearly twice as long as broad, tapering, throughout, much compressed, early portion with the periphery entire and slightly keeled, later moderatly indented; chambers in the microspheric form mostly slightly broader than high, in the megalospheric form with the later chambers with the height often as great or greater than the breadth, later ones more inflated but somewhat compressed throughout; sutures in the early portion slightly limbate, in the adult depressed; wall in the early portion coarsely punctulate, somewhat roughened, in the adult smooth and polished; aperture higher than broad, arched with a slight lip and flanges at the sides extending onto the preceding chamber.

Most likely ancestor: Laeviheterohelix pulchra - at confidence level 3 (out of 5). Data source: Nederbragt 1991.

Geological Range:
Last occurrence (top): within A. mayaroensis zone (67.30-69.18Ma, top in Maastrichtian stage). Data source: [copied from Chronos database]
First occurrence (base): within G. havanensis zone (74.00-75.71Ma, base in Campanian stage). Data source: [copied from Chronos database]
